    Unfortunately, unprotected sex just one time can get you pregnant. How long ago did the sex occur? How long after the unprotected sex did you go to the doctor?

    Sometimes HPT's can read negative when you actually are pregnant. It happened to me. Some women never get a positive result on HPT's, and some don't get one until the middle of pregnancy. The symptoms you have described can be pregnancy symptoms but they can also be symptoms of other things as well.

    I know you said you can't exactly afford to go to the doctor, but it is recommended that you do. Did you get a blood test at the doctor, or urine? Blood tests are a lot more accurate.

    If at all possible, you should get a blood test. If you go to a clinic rather than your regular doctor, it is usually at a lower cost. You can also try Planned Parenthood. Here is their website : Planned Parenthood Federation of America, Inc.

    You can search for a location near you and call them and see what they can do. They are also usually low cost, if they charge anything at all.

    It is possbile that you are just having an irregular period. There are many things that can cause this, such as stress, diet and some medications. These factors can also cause you to skip a period. But to be on the safe side, I would get checked out. Enough time should have gone by, by now, that it should pick up in a blood test. You can also try taking a couple of more HPTs and see what they say. First Response is the only one that worked for me. If it is negative, it is probably just irregularity.
